Amid the accelerating race to secure energy resources for the computing revolution, Jericho Energy Ventures and Comstock Holding Companies have entered a definitive agreement to form Oklahoma AI Ventures LLC. The joint venture is focused on acquiring and developing land around Jericho's existing energy infrastructure in Oklahoma to support AI data centers. This move formalizes a strategic Letter of Intent previously announced in February 2026, establishing a clear operational path for both entities.
This alliance reflects a broader market trend where small and mid-cap energy firms seek to capitalize on the AI boom, mirroring moves by sector leaders like Vistra and Constellation Energy. Per market data, securing direct access to power sources has become a critical competitive advantage in the industrial real estate sector. The venture aims to combine Comstock’s development expertise with Jericho’s strategic energy assets to create a scalable infrastructure platform.
